Li Keqiang Meets with King Philippe of Belgium

2017-06-03 16:49

On the afternoon of June 2, 2017 local time, Premier Li Keqiang met with King Philippe of Belgium at the Royal Palace of Brussels.

Li Keqiang firstly conveyed President Xi Jinping's warm greetings to King Philippe, and expressed that China and Belgium enjoy a profound traditional friendship and increasingly intensified exchanges. President Xi Jinping and Your Majesty have successfully exchanged visits, which injects strong impetus into the development of China-Belgium relations. China is willing to continuously make joint efforts with Belgium to align development strategies, make use of complementary advantages, enhance connectivity, and deepen cooperation in high-tech, energy conservation, environmental protection and other fields, in a bid to push forward the development of bilateral relations.

Li Keqiang pointed out that the course of China's deepening reform and expanding opening up bears great market opportunities. The Chinese side welcomes more Belgian enterprises to invest and establish business in China, so as to better achieve bilateral mutual benefit and win-win results.

Philippe expressed that Belgium and China enjoy a long-standing friendship. He visited China many times, and was deeply impressed by China's great achievements made in its opening up. The Belgian side is glad to see the opportunities brought by China's development to the region and the world at large, and stands ready to, together with China, deepen cooperation, intensify communication in international affairs, and jointly address global challenges.

Both sides also exchanged views on bilateral, international and regional issues of common concern.
